IT Domain Architect - Data and Integration in Charlotte, NC at Coca-Cola Consolidated, Inc.

Date Posted: 4/22/2021

Job Snapshot

Job Description

Requisition ID:  19823 

Posting Locations: Charlotte 

Click here to view a Day in the Life of our Teammates!



Job Overview

The Data and Integration Architect is an experienced and seasoned Solutions Architect/Engineer with a broad range of technical skills and a deep understanding of software design patterns and technologies used in complex solution development. This position will be expected to actively guide the technical design and development processes as a subject matter expert for multiple concurrent major projects and large system enhancements. This position will be expected to develop a deep understanding of multiple complex systems, and how they fit together, from both a business process and technical perspective



Duties & Responsibilities

Primary responsibilities include, but are not limited to:

  • Leverages domain expertise in enterprise-level integration architecture to enable efficient data movement across all solutions.
  • Serves as a domain expert and leads the definition of the enterprise integration framework, patterns, toolsets, and processes.
  • Serves as a key member in defining the enterprise’s future state data landscape by continuously analyzing current trends within the industry and presenting strategies and recommendations to the larger Architecture team for inclusion in the technology roadmap.
  • Proactively mentors developer and architect peers in regards to system knowledge and development technologies and processes, as well as performing design reviews ensuring compliance with CCCI reference architecture and best practices.
  • Assembly and presentation of technical options to project teams and management where needed.
  • Primarily works outside of the Agile & Delivery teams to provide the foundational support required to meet the needs inside the delivery teams or other Communities of Service.


Minimum Qualifications

  • ​​​​3+ years architecture experience (by role or function)
  • 7+ Years of experience spanning at least two IT disciplines/domains, including technical architecture, application development, middleware, database management, cloud management, mobile management
  • 5+ years within the domain of data & integration with a proven record of implementing solutions, frameworks, and processes to meet both architectural and business needs
  • 3+ years of MS Azure (strongly preferred) or other cloud computing provider experience - serverless computing, service-oriented concepts, distributed systems
  • Experience with RESTful API design concepts with a strong preference for resource-centric design, advanced level understanding of API-First design principles, and familiarity with the Open API Specification (OAS)
  • Experience with API Gateway and API Management concepts and platforms
  • Advanced understanding of integration types, frequency, and consistency considerations (i.e. real-time, near-real time, batch, eventual consistency, file-based, event-based, ETL/ELT, API, sFTP, etc.)
  • Strong understanding of the authentication and authorization considerations related to data and integration (i.e. oAuth, data masking, least-privilege concepts)
  • Strong understanding of monitoring and logging requirements of distributed systems and services along with the ability to design stable solutions within this paradigm.
  • Strong communication skills, proven experience in complex process documentation, and an ability to communicate with both technical and business partners


Preferred Qualifications

  • Experience with messaging and queues, pub-sub patterns, and event-driven concepts
  • Experience with data modeling and domain-driven design
  • Understanding of API Testing methodologies and toolsets such as ReadyAPI, LoadUI, Postman, Dredd, or other API governance and testing tools
  • Certifications within the Data and/or Integration domain
  • Experience with CI/CD DevOps Concepts and Practices
  • Familiarity with Master Data Management concepts (Data Cataloging, Data Lineage, Data Quality and Reconciliation, etc.)


Work Environment

Office Environment

Coca-Cola Consolidated, Inc. is an Equal Opportunity Employer.

Not Ready To Apply?

Joining our Talent Network will enhance your job search and application process. Whether you choose to apply or just leave your information, we look forward to staying connected with you.

Join Our Talent Network